Bitcoin Block 304942

Block Details

Hash0000000000000000519ba6563957335e037c8e05254341b83f18498a755dca7f
Timestamp
Transactions476
AddressesView addresses
Size289.89 KB
Weight1,159,552 WU
Total fees0.06669965 BTC
Avg fee rate23.0 sat/vB
Block reward25.06669965 BTC
Inputs / Outputs1,523 / 1,072
RBF signaling1 (0.2%)
Difficulty1.18e+10
Merkle root6cf307ad544f8d19218dc8a76f6b87d8e30645f8aafbad5890523d6f961a5a0e
Nonce530,269,638
Version0x00000002
Previous block00000000000000002e6e118145833af3c6c0ffcba90c9428894215c07620810c
Next blockBlock 304943 →

Block Visualization

Block Statistics

See how this block compares to network trends: